The global oil and gas industry is a cornerstone of the world economy, providing the energy and raw materials that drive industries, infrastructure, and everyday life. Despite the push for renewable energy sources, hydrocarbons remain the dominant energy source, supplying over 80% of global energy consumption in 2023. According to recent industry reports, oil demand is projected to reach 105 million barrels per day by 2026, underscoring the sector’s continued relevance. The industry, however, faces significant disruptions due to energy transitions, regulatory changes, digital transformation, and market volatility, creating a need for professionals who can navigate these complexities with strategic insight.
